From: Alex Zhuravlev Date: Wed, 5 Jun 2019 13:38:27 +0000 (+0300) Subject: LU-12392 utils: specify correct size for the buffer X-Git-Tag: 2.12.56~89 X-Git-Url: https://git.whamcloud.com/?a=commitdiff_plain;h=7babde7afc54712c5e62d8cf47ab2481a0efc598;p=fs%2Flustre-release.git LU-12392 utils: specify correct size for the buffer otherwise gcc8 makes a warning which interrupts build. Change-Id: I6a94c6cd63473df9fc88b1867bbda1353fa10247 Signed-off-by: Alex Zhuravlev Reviewed-on: https://review.whamcloud.com/35070 Reviewed-by: Andreas Dilger Reviewed-by: Oleg Drokin Reviewed-by: Wang Shilong Tested-by: Jenkins Tested-by: Maloo Reviewed-by: James Simmons --- diff --git a/lustre/utils/lfs.c b/lustre/utils/lfs.c index 4f21ced..5e37d9a 100644 --- a/lustre/utils/lfs.c +++ b/lustre/utils/lfs.c @@ -5565,7 +5565,7 @@ static int lfs_setdirstripe(int argc, char **argv) lsb->sb_count = 0; /* use mntdir for dirname() temporarily */ - strncpy(mntdir, dname, sizeof(mntdir)); + strncpy(mntdir, dname, sizeof(mntdir) - 1); if (!realpath(dirname(mntdir), path)) { result = -errno; fprintf(stderr,